On average across the year,
yes, Kentucky, United States is hotter than
Rapid City, South Dakota
.
Kentucky, United States has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F and Rapid City, South Dakota has an average temperature of 6°C/43°F.
Kentucky,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F, which is hotter than Rapid City, South Dakota's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 28°C/82°F).
On average across the year, no, Kentucky, United States is not colder than Rapid City, South Dakota . Kentucky, United States has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F and Rapid City, South Dakota has an average minimum temperature of -2°C/28°F.
